Output 7ad84394255b16a38bf0f8dd02c1e4fff5d74f63ac341dec91b554f82cae6103:14

value
456813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dc2f4b5ec53f81192e31bd4020fcf9102d983de OP_EQUAL
address
3BhP8E71DjmbAA5xjmrf51ZqhxNxp7E1cD
transaction
7ad84394255b16a38bf0f8dd02c1e4fff5d74f63ac341dec91b554f82cae6103